Analyst Expect Big Moves From Avino Silver & Gold Mines Ltd (AMEX: ASM)

Currently, there are 144.77M common shares owned by the public and among those 136.89M shares have been available to trade.

The company’s stock has a 5-day price change of 5.99% and 172.31% over the past three months. ASM shares are trading 301.82% year to date (YTD), with the 12-month market performance up to 250.50% higher. It has a 12-month low price of $0.83 and touched a high of $3.74 over the same period. ASM has an average intraday trading volume of 4.16 million shares. The stock is trading above its simple moving averages at the SMA20, SMA50, and SMA200, as the current price level is off by 16.45%, 46.38%, and 134.83% respectively.

Institutional ownership of Avino Silver & Gold Mines Ltd (AMEX: ASM) shares accounts for 10.80% of the company’s 144.77M shares outstanding.

It has a market capitalization of $512.49M and a beta (3y monthly) value of 1.66. The stock’s trailing 12-month PE ratio is 37.30, while the earnings-per-share (ttm) stands at $0.09. The company has a PEG of 0.61 and a Quick Ratio of 2.45 with the debt-to-equity ratio at 0.04. Price movements for the stock have been influenced by the stock’s volatility, which stands at 1.17% over the week and 4.84% over the month.

Earnings per share for the fiscal year are expected to increase by 141.67%, and 39.66% over the next financial year.

H.C. Wainwright coverage for the Avino Silver & Gold Mines Ltd (ASM) stock in a research note released on February 14, 2018 offered a Buy rating with a price target of $3.25. Rodman & Renshaw was of a view on January 24, 2017 that the stock is Buy, while Euro Pacific Capital gave the stock Buy rating on March 28, 2016, issuing a price target of $1.80- $2.10. H.C. Wainwright on their part issued Buy rating on May 30, 2014.
